Leadership Review Briefing — Orvane Line Pricing

Heads of department: Orvane margins fell to 22% after the Q2 input-cost spike. Options on the table: 6% list increase, trim the entry SKU, or renegotiate with Hallowfen Metals. Competitor Tessbridge has not moved prices. Decision needed at Thursday's review. The pricing committee's confidential recommendation is set out below.

board note of bawep-tajef: Queniusek Systems plans to raise the Quenvan list price by 53.1 percent in March. The pricing group signed off on a budget of $176.4 million for Project Drueth. The renewal with Casionix Partners closes at $142.5 million a year, 8.3 percent below the last contract. Project Fraax slips by six weeks because of the tooling delay.

Ticket: Staging env misconfigured for Siftgate bloom filter

The bloom layer in front of the Pellet KV store is rejecting all lookups in staging because the env file was copied from the dev template without credentials. False-positive tuning values are fine; only the auth line is missing. To unblock the weekly demo, the Pellet admission secret must be set on the following line.

env line for yaguf-fajop: LEDGER_TOKEN13=fb08984397349

Onboarding: Inkfold renderer. Inkfold turns Marrowby billing data into PDF invoices. Releases cut from main, Tuesdays. Run the render snapshot suite before tagging; any pixel diff over 0.5% blocks the release. Fonts are vendored — never pull from the agent cache. All release bundles must be signed before upload to the Dockleaf registry. Sign with the following key.

deploy key for kahof-tadup: bky4_rRMZ